Period freehold premises formed from two adjoining terraced properties, both with retail accommodation on the ground floor and ancillary on the upper parts. In addition to the retail ground floor, Number 1 has a basement area, staff welfare and office on the first floor and stores above on a second floor. Number 3 Adelaide Street has ground floor retail floorspace and an attractive open plan stores/ ancillary area to the first floor. The premises have been in retail use for many years and renowned as the first Seasalt shop est. in 1981.

A village roadside Inn with public bar and breakout dining areas to provide space for c85 internal covers, with commercial kitchen, 7 letting bedrooms and outbuildings. The original building is believed to date from the 16th century with later extensions, predominately to the rear. There are many traditional features, such as flagstone style flooring, exposed timbers and wood panelling. Although at present the premises are considered somewhat dated in terms of repair, with investment required throughout, the location and character will underpin any investment made . The first floor provides for 7 letting bedrooms, 1 bed apartment and one non en suite bedroom. To the rear is an L shaped single storey building to include 2 former staff bedrooms, shower and WC, various storage rooms, two beer cellars and laundry. Externally there is an enclosed courtyard patio to the rear, small patio by the main customer entrance, with level beer garden accessed over the car park entrance and providing space for c60 covers. There is a surface level car park for c24 vehicles, surrounded on two sides with residential accommodation. The property has been owned as an investment with tenants in situ. It is now available closed and with vacant possession.
